The Legal Maze: Knowing Your Rights and Responsibilities

One of the most crucial aspects of online gambling, especially for Australians, is understanding the legal framework. Laws vary significantly across different jurisdictions, and staying informed is paramount. While the Interactive Gambling Act 2001 (IGA) regulates online gambling in Australia, it’s a complex piece of legislation. It’s essential to know which operators are licensed and regulated, and which are not. Unlicensed operators can pose significant risks, including unfair practices and lack of player protection. Always check for licensing information from reputable regulatory bodies, such as the Northern Territory Racing Commission or the Australian Communications and Media Authority (ACMA). Familiarize yourself with the specific regulations in your state or territory, as these can impact the types of games you can play and the payment methods you can use. Ignoring the legalities can lead to serious consequences, including fines and legal action, so do your homework.

Bonuses and Promotions: Maximizing Your Value

Online casinos are notorious for offering a myriad of bonuses and promotions to attract players. While these can be enticing, it’s crucial to understand the terms and conditions before claiming them. Wagering requirements, game restrictions, and time limits can significantly impact the value of a bonus. Look for bonuses with reasonable wagering requirements and games that contribute favorably to those requirements. Loyalty programs and VIP schemes can also offer significant benefits for regular players, including cashback, exclusive bonuses, and personalized service. Don’t be swayed by the size of the bonus alone; focus on the overall value and how it aligns with your playing style.

Payment Methods and Security: Protecting Your Funds

The security of your funds and personal information is paramount. Choose online casinos that offer secure and reputable payment methods. Credit cards, e-wallets (like PayPal, Neteller, and Skrill), and bank transfers are common options. Always ensure that the casino uses encryption technology to protect your data. Before providing any financial information, verify the casino’s security measures, such as SSL encryption. Be wary of casinos that offer limited payment options or require excessive personal information. Keep your login details secure and avoid using public Wi-Fi networks when accessing your casino account. Regularly review your transaction history and report any suspicious activity immediately.

Responsible Gambling: Staying in Control

Even for experienced gamblers, responsible gambling is crucial in the online environment. The accessibility and anonymity of online casinos can make it easier to lose track of time and money. Set limits on your deposits, wagers, and losses. Utilize the self-exclusion tools offered by online casinos if you feel you’re losing control. Take regular breaks and avoid chasing losses. Remember that gambling should be a form of entertainment, not a source of income. If you’re struggling with problem gambling, seek help from professional organizations like Gambling Help Online or Lifeline. Your well-being is more important than any win or loss.
